Originally called Caffè alla Venezia trionfante, the coffee house soon became known as Caffè Florian, after its original owner and founder Floriano Francesconi. Founded in 1846, Caffè Paszkowski is another florentine coffee house which to this day is still a favorite hangout of intellectuals. During the insurrection against Austria in 1848, revolutionaries chose Caffè Florian as their headquarters, and it was here that the conspirators demanded the liberation of Niccolò Tommaseo and Daniele Manin, who proclaimed the rebirth of the Republic of San Marco. Housed in the fifteenth-century Palazzo Agostini, on the Lungarno, Caffè dell’Ussero counts some illustrious patrons who came here as students: Giosuè Carducci (the first Italian Nobel Prize laureate), Filippo Mazzei (an Italian-born patriot and close friend of Thomas Jefferson from who inspired the great doctrine “All men are created equal” and incorporated into the Declaration of Independence by Jefferson), Alessandro D’Ancona (first director of the newspaper La Nazione), Giuseppe Giusti (who made the café famous in his Memorie di Pisa of 1841), Cesare Abba,  Indro Montanelli, among many others. In 1733, the swiss Gilli family opened the Bottega dei Pani Dolci (The sweet breads Boutique) on Via de’ Calzaiuoli, which soon became a favorite among the florentine well-to-do. This very old café, frequented by Giacomo Pucini and many foreign artists, was originally known as the Antico Café del Caselli. Later on it was renamed Cafè Di Simo but the original furnishing and decoration in Liberty style were preserved, as were the numerous souvenirs of famous visitors. The monument of Liberty-style is said to have been also a favorite of King Umberto I and Edward VII of England who enjoyed to have a Bitter at the wood inlaid bar, crafted by Eugenio Quarti. The day is defined by coffee rituals: a cappuccino with breakfast, a caffè macchiato – or two – as an afternoon pick-me-up, and espresso after dinner. Caffè Nazionale is housed on the ground floor of a beautiful neo-classical Palazzo that also accommodates the Municipio (town hall) of Aosta. The name of the coffee house derives from the Toscan and literary variant of the Italian word ussaro (from the French word hussard: a soldier in a light cavalry regiment, originally an hungarian military term. The coffee house was frequented by many famous and influential people of the past, such as the Italian premier Zanardelli, Eugenio Torelli Viollier (the co-founder of Il Corriere), the politician and poet Cavallotti, and the publisher Giulio Ricordi. In the second half of the Nineteenth century, the coffee house was renovated in neoclassical style and renamed Caffè del Tasso. It is said that Charles Albert, King of Piedmont-Sardinia, before starting his morning audiences, used to ask: “What did they say at Fiorio’s?” because it was the meeting place of the most influential thinkers.
